Start your job searchMy client a well-established Financial services business. They are looking for a part or fully qualified accountant who has an interest in supporting customers and driving change.
As a payments and projects accountant sitting in the financial controls team you will play a crucial part in ensuring customers can fulfil their transactions in a safe and efficient way whilst complying within a regulated environment.
You will be an expert on payments and work as a business partner to various areas. Collaborating with colleagues from other areas to identify, test and implement payments solutions which lead to positive change for customers.
Your day to day duties will include:
- Review regulatory change within the industry relating to payments and analyse their impact on the business, and consider how these changes can be implemented across the business
- Work on all phases of payments related projects through to their delivery
- Liaise closely and business partner with non-finance stakeholders within the business, influencing positive change
- Lead work streams and attend project workshops to ensure departmental requirements are captured
- Work closely with team members to integrate project related initiatives into day to day activities
- Challenge existing processes within the department and identify system and process improvement
- Deputise for Financial Control Lead and coach junior members of the team
Required skills and knowledge:
- Knowledge of payment schemes and systems
- Knowledge of Oracle E-Business Suite
- Experience of end to end process reviews
- Excellent numerical and financial awareness
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Be studying ACCA or CIMA- Part qualified or qualified
- Desire to study Certificate in Payments qualification
- Significant relevant experience
